Course details

Introduction to Quantum Computing: Basics of quantum mechanics, qubits, superposition, and entanglement.
Quantum Algorithms: Overview of quantum algorithms, including Shor's, Grover's, and quantum error correction.
Quantum Hardware and Architectures: Types of quantum hardware, including superconducting qubits, trapped ions, and topological qubits.
Quantum Programming and Software Tools: Quantum programming languages (Q#, Qiskit, etc.), and software tools.
Quantum Applications in Geriatric Counseling: Use of quantum computing in geriatric counseling, including drug discovery, medical imaging, and mental health assessment.
Quantum Cryptography and Security: Quantum key distribution, quantum-resistant cryptography, and secure communication.
Ethics and Societal Implications: Ethical considerations, societal impact, and responsible innovation in quantum computing.
Quantum Computing in Healthcare: Overview of quantum computing applications in healthcare, including medical research, diagnostics, and personalized medicine.
Quantum Computing Trends and Future Directions: Current trends and future directions in quantum computing research and development.
